The game titled Assassin’s Creed Shadows is the next major installment of the Assassin’s Creed series, following Mirage. This game has a unique dual-protagonist system, switching between characters named Naoe and Yasuke. Just recently, Ubisoft announced that they are pushing back the release date for this action-adventure RPG from November 12, 2024, to some point in 2025.

This expansion for the franchise is quite expansive, offering a deeply immersive journey seen from the perspectives of two extraordinary characters. However, we understand that additional time is necessary to perfect and enhance certain aspects, focusing more on refining key elements.

Consequently, we’ve chosen to move the release date to February 14, 2025. On this day, you’ll find our game available across multiple platforms like Steam from the get-go. Furthermore, any existing preorders will be refunded and new ones will come with the first expansion package for free.

It’s unfortunate that we have to share this news, which may be disheartening for those eagerly anticipating an Assassin’s Creed game set in Feudal Japan. However, we genuinely feel that this decision is beneficial for the game itself and will enhance your playing experience as a whole.

However, here’s an interesting point: As PHBrazil reports, a reliable source within Ubisoft claims that Assassin’s Creed Shadows is delayed due to being in disarray at the moment, and they can’t sugarcoat it for the time being. (If you understand Portuguese, you can skip to 3:37.)

Furthermore, the source asserts that Ubisoft’s choice to postpone Shadows and opt for a more polished release instead might stem from the recent setback experienced with Star Wars Outlaws—a high-profile project that fell short of the company’s hopes.

According to a recent update from Ubisoft, while Star Wars Outlaws received strong reviews (Metacritic 76) and high user scores (3.9/5) suggesting an engaging and authentic Star Wars experience across multiple platforms, its initial sales were disappointingly lower than anticipated.
